Understanding SIM-capable routers
A SIM-capable router is a device that can accept a SIM card and connect to cellular networks (4G/LTE or 5G) to provide internet to devices on your home network. Unlike traditional routers that rely on a fixed broadband line, these devices integrate a modem, a SIM interface, and often multiple WAN options. There are two common implementations: embedded SIM (eSIM) slot or a removable physical SIM card that accepts standard micro or nano SIM sizes (via an adapter). Some models include an integrated 4G/5G modem, while others rely on detachable USB modems. When you turn on the device, it negotiates with the mobile network just like a smartphone, assigns IP addresses to connected devices, and can support features such as NAT, firewall, QoS, and guest networks. It’s important to verify that the router supports the bands your carrier uses and whether the device can operate in your country. In many setups, you’ll also be able to combine a SIM WAN with Ethernet WAN for automatic failover or load balancing.
How SIM cards power WAN for routers
When a router uses a SIM card, the cellular network becomes its wide area network (WAN). The data travels over carrier towers to the router’s onboard modem, and from there to your devices via Wi‑Fi or Ethernet. This is particularly valuable in locations with poor fixed-line service, during outages, or for mobile setups such as RVs or temporary offices. In most cases, you insert a valid SIM, power on the device, and activate a data plan with the chosen carrier. APN settings may be required to route traffic through the provider’s network; some routers auto-detect APN, while others require manual entry. The speed you get depends on the SIM’s plan, signal strength, network congestion, and the modem’s category (for example, CAT 6/12 for 4G or 5G NR for faster speeds). Note that some networks restrict tethering or simultaneous connections; it’s essential to confirm terms before choosing a plan.
Choosing the right hardware for SIM
Look for a few critical features: a dedicated SIM slot or eSIM, a capable modem (ideally supporting 4G and 5G bands used by your region), and robust wired backup options (Ethernet WAN) in case cellular is unavailable. Battery life is less relevant for home use but matters for portable setups. The router should support dual-band Wi‑Fi, strong antenna options, and good heat management. Some models are designed specifically for mobile use and include satellite-like indicators for signal strength and coverage. If you plan to travel with the router, consider compact form factor and power options (AC and DC). Also, verify firmware update policies and whether the device supports the latest security standards and NAT types. Finally, ensure the device supports the APN format required by your carrier and whether it locks the SIM card to a single provider.
Setup steps: from SIM to internet
- Install the SIM card and power on the router. 2) Access the admin interface via a browser or app. 3) Navigate to the WAN or Mobile settings and select Mobile as the primary WAN. 4) Enter the APN, username, and password if required by your carrier. 5) Save your settings and reboot if necessary. 6) Enable Wi‑Fi and test connectivity from a connected device. 7) If Ethernet is available, you can configure it as a failover or load-balanced WAN to improve reliability. Finally, consider enabling data usage monitoring to avoid excessive charges. If you encounter issues, verify SIM recognition, check SIM unlock status, and ensure the router’s firmware is up to date.
APN settings and data plans: what to know
APN settings tell the router how to reach the carrier’s data network. In many regions, you’ll use standard APNs supplied by the carrier; some carriers require a username/password. If your provider offers an eSIM, the activation procedure may differ slightly. For data plans, choose a tier that matches your anticipated usage—graphic streaming and online gaming will eat data quickly. If you’re using a shared family plan, monitor usage per device with built-in QoS or parental controls. Roaming can be expensive, so if you’re traveling, ensure your plan includes international or roaming data. Many carriers also impose a cap on tethering, which you’ll want to verify before relying on the SIM WAN for constant connectivity.
Performance, coverage, and bandwidth considerations
Cellular WAN performance depends on signal strength, network congestion, and the modem’s capabilities. Indoor signals can be boosted with external antennas or placement near windows, while exterior antennas often require mounting. Band support matters: faster 5G networks require a modem that supports the appropriate NR bands. Data speeds on 4G can range widely, from practical uploads to streaming near HD quality. Many routers support QoS to prioritize video calls or gaming; ensure your firmware enables this feature and that you configure it properly. In terms of latency, cellular networks typically have higher ping than fixed broadband, especially during peak hours. If you need consistent performance, a dual-WAN setup with a reliable fixed connection as a backup can provide resilience.

Troubleshooting common issues
First, verify the router recognizes the SIM card and that the carrier’s service is active. If the device shows 'no SIM' or 'invalid SIM,' check SIM orientation, contact the carrier to unlock or provision the SIM, and confirm the device isn’t blocked. Ensure APN details are correct; misconfigurations can prevent data from flowing. If pages load slowly, verify signal strength and consider rebooting both the router and the modem. If you’re not seeing any traffic, check that the WAN is set to Mobile and that the Ethernet WAN isn’t stealing the primary connection. Finally, keep the firmware up to date to avoid known bugs that affect SIM-based WAN.

Security and privacy with cellular WAN
Even with a cellular WAN, you still benefit from standard router security. Use strong encryption (WPA2 or WPA3), enable a firewall, and keep firmware updated. Consider segmenting IoT devices on a separate guest network to minimize exposure. Some carriers offer built-in threat protection or VPN options; check compatibility with your router. Also, be mindful of SIM-specific security concerns, such as SIM swapping risks and incorrect APN configurations that could expose your network. Regularly review connected devices and monitor traffic for unusual patterns, especially if you rely on mobile broadband as your primary home Internet.
